Westlake ST205/75R15 Trailer Tire and Chrome Wheel
Question:
do you sell a westlake 205/75-15 radial 8 ply with a chrome rim. if so how much
asked by: Willis A
Expert Reply:
We do have an option for a Westlake ST205/75R15 trailer tire and a chrome rim, though they do come separate as opposed to the tire already being mounted on the wheel. For the tire, what you will need is the Westlake ST205/75R15 Radial Trailer Tire # LHWL300.
This is an 8-ply tire like you wanted, and is a load range D with a capacity of 2,150 lbs. This is one of the better trailer tires available due to its deep 10/32" tread depth for the best traction, and tread wear indicator so you know exactly how much life is left on the tires.
Then the option for a chrome wheel is the Steel Directional Trailer Wheel - 15" x 5" Rim - 5 on 4-1/2 - Chrome Finish # AM34FR.
This wheel does have a 5 on 4-1/2" bolt pattern so you'll want to make sure your trailer hub has the same pattern; if you aren't sure what yours is I have added links below to a help article and printable template which you can use to determine what your bolt pattern is.
For lug nuts to mount the wheel you will need the Lionshead Trailer Wheel Lug Nut # LHLR103. All prices are on their respective product pages, and I have also added links to video reviews for you to check out as well if you'd like.
